Job Description

We seek a skilled Equipment Technician to join our team. The successful candidate will help build, modify, test, and troubleshoot custom equipment/machines/systems for various industries, including semiconductor process equipment, aerospace, automotive/EV, energy, and medical devices. This role involves working with a seasoned team of Mechanical, Electrical, Robotics, Automation, Manufacturing, Hardware, and Software Engineers, as well as other Technicians.

Responsibilities:

  • Build, modify, test, and troubleshoot custom equipment/machines/systems.
  • Work from engineering input, schematics, electrical diagrams, interconnect diagrams, blueprints, customer input, and specifications.
  • Document procedures and results.
  • Troubleshoot at component, systems, and board levels.
  • Perform upgrades and calibrations.
  • Understand voltages and currents.
  • Work in a manufacturing floor environment on R&D prototype and experimental equipment.
  • Support customers and travel to customer sites for installations and bring-up.
  • Attend team meetings for discoveries.

Requirements:

  • Knowledge and/or ability to work on multiple product lines and products from multiple industries.
  • Preferred knowledge of panels and control boxes.
  • Proficient in using test equipment such as Oscilloscopes, Digital Multi-Meters, Measuring Equipment, Automated Test Equipment, and other types of scopes.
  • Ability to remove, replace, and re-test all types of parts, assemblies, sub-assemblies, boxes, power supplies, transformers, heating elements, cooling fans, etc.
  • Skilled in using hand and power tools such as wrenches, screwdrivers, sockets, electrical drills, etc.
  • Experience in wiring and cable & and harness work – routing, placements, and testing.
  • Ability to swap out PCBs and re-test as needed, including rework of boards and soldering.
  • Understanding of components such as resistors, diodes, capacitors, chips, microprocessors, etc.
  • Ability to identify issues, provide solutions, and escalate issues as needed.
  • Physical agility and the ability to maneuver around machines.
  • Multi-tasking abilities to shift priorities as needed.
  • Excellent communication skills – technical, written, verbal, listening, comprehension, and action.
  • 5-15 years of experience preferred.
  • Associates or Bachelor’s Degree preferred.

• • Ability to travel as required – passport or proper ID.
